Key highlights:
- The Zilliqa team recently released version 3.4.8 of the Scilla plugin for Hardhat, simplifying the development experience for building on Zilliqa.
- Some handy improvements include no longer needing to do manual compilations – the plugin now automates that process.
- It also fixes bugs, adds better event logging for tests, and allows using multiple accounts.
The development of blockchain applications and smart contracts can be a complex process involving several different programming languages, frameworks, and environments. Thankfully, the team behind Zilliqa is continuously working to simplify this process through tools like the Scilla plugin for Hardhat. Their latest update brings valuable new features that developers will find quite handy.
What’s new in v3.4.8 of the Scilla plugin?
In a recent blog post, the Zilliqa team announced the release of version 3.4.8 of the Scilla plugin for Hardhat. This plugin allows developers to test Scilla-based smart contracts right within the Hardhat environment in much the same way Ethers.js handles Solidity. Among the key improvements in the latest version:
- No more manual builds required. Previously, users had to explicitly build Scilla binaries, adding friction. Now, the plugin runs Scilla tools via containers, removing that hurdle. Just have Docker installed and you’re ready to go.
- Various bug fixes and stability enhancements under the hood. Developers will appreciate smoothed over rough edges.
- Event log translators for simpler testing. Chai assertions can now more easily match Scilla events emitted during contract execution.
- Support for multiple Hardhat accounts. Tests involving different addresses now pose no problems.
The latest version of the Scilla plugin for #Hardhat has been released, bringing helpful new features to devs building on Zilliqa EVM!
Check out the latest features in v3.4.8 of the plugin below:https://t.co/NxXw6ZNQbx#Zilliqa #Blockchain
— Zilliqa (@zilliqa) September 8, 2023
Simplifying the development experience
The goal of updates like this is to produce a development experience for Scilla and Zilliqa that closely mimics what Ethereum developers know with Solidity and tools like Hardhat, Truffle and Ganache. Removing frictions around compiling and running Scilla contracts means developers can focus primarily on writing code rather than wrestling with environments.
As the blog post notes, containers have replaced the need for manual builds. For most hackers, this means Scilla is just another language they can use within Hardhat without extra steps. With challenges of setting up Scilla locally now vanquished, the barrier to exploring Zilliqa dApps lowers considerably.
Building interoperability and a thriving ecosystem
It’s clear the Zilliqa team recognizes the importance of tooling in growing an ecosystem. Lowering the burden of blockchain development makes the whole process more approachable and sustainable long-term. Their goal of achieving near feature-parity between Solidity and Scilla development pipelines bodes well for collaborative efforts between the networks down the road.
Interoperability features like treating ZRC-2 tokens as ERC-20s from a smart contract perspective pave the way for asset movement between chains. As these integration points multiply, developers can readily experiment with ideas that span multiple blockchains. An thriving ecosystem benefits all participants through network effects and innovation.
So how has the Zilliqa price reacted currently? As per CoinCodex data, ZIL saw a 24-hour price increase of around 1% over the past day, rising from $0.0163 to its current $0.0165.
From a technical analysis standpoint, Zilliqa’s short-term 50-day moving average is trending downwards according to CoinCodex price forecasts of ZIL. The longer 200-day average also remains in decline. Overall sentiment appears neutral to bearish based on the site’s indicators.
Updates like the latest Scilla plugin for Hardhat make the nitty gritty of blockchain development much less gritty. Simplified environments translate to greater productivity and smarter use of time.
Source: https://coincodex.com/article/32080/zilliqa-price-sees-small-price-bump-as-new-features-for-devs-building-on-zilliqa-evm-go-live/